Total Time: 1 hr 20 minsCategory: Main CourseCalories: 389 per serving1. Rinse the rice and peanuts first. Add 2.5 cups water.
2. Soak 1 tbsp tightly packed tamarind in 1/2 or 2/3 cup warm water for 25 to 30 mins.
3. Now in the cooker with the mashed dal, add the cooked rice and peanuts.
4. In a another pan or the tadka (tempering) pan, heat ghee or oil first. Crackle the mustard seeds and then temper the curry leaves, marathi moggu, dry red chilies, cashews and asafoetida till the dry red chilies change color and the cashews turn a light golden. Don't burn the spices.
